OEM Account Manager (USA: Dallas, TX)
COMPANY OVERVIEW:
M-Files Inc., the developer of a state of the art software application called M-Files, is making waves in the large and growing document management software market. M-Files is ideally positioned to disrupt this multi-billion dollar market that has been historically dominated by traditional complex and expensive "enterprise" content management solutions.
With its ease of use, power and affordability, M-Files represents a unique solution that meets the document management needs of virtually any company in any industry, regardless of size. With over 140,000 M-Files licenses in use at 16,000+ customers around the world, a growth rate close to 100%, and a product that is truly different than the competition, M-Files has an incredibly bright future.
M-Files in Dallas, Texas, is looking for an experienced, talented, and motivated OEM Account Manager to help us develop our OEM sales model in North America. This is truly a "get in on the ground floor" career opportunity.
JOB DESCRIPTION A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
As an M-Files OEM Account Manager, you will play a critical role in driving our success through the continued growth of our indirect sales channel. You will need to grasp the fundamentals of the M-Files document management software, have a true hunter mentality and professional approach that will enable you to identify and build relationships with prospective OEM partners, sign them as formal business partners, and then help them successfully add the M-Files platform to their technology.
Your primary day-to-day tasks will consist of:
- Develop opportunities, demonstrate, advise on, promote and sell our OEM solutions by identifying new prospects and business cases that would benefit from the M-Files technology platform.
- Maintain relationships with existing OEM customers in order to ensure continued success and jointly identify additional uses of the M-Files technology platform.
- Use knowledge of software licensing and distribution and financial modeling techniques, including net present value, to illustrate the value of the M-Files technology platform and construct win-win business models.
- Prospect for new leads, demonstrate M-Files solutions, draft high quality proposals, manage technical evaluations as a part of the standard sales process.
- Management of customer and internal expectations and requirements are essential. Candidates must be able to manage the sales process, including all touch points in the account (client business owners and C-levels to internal marketing, sales, tech, services, etc.), in support of a revenue outcome in a forecasted period of time.
- Meet or exceed quarterly revenue targets through required prospecting, pipeline management and opportunity sales process management. Maintain relevant data in our CRM tool by recording all significant sales activity for each account or opportunity, including forecasts, in an accurate and timely fashion.
- Review royalty reports for consistency and accuracy as well as monitor license status within existing customers to maximize revenue capture and opportunity.
- Help refine our OEM sales and marketing materials.
- Create objectives & strategies which will contribute to the overall business plan to achieve sales goals.
MINIMUM EXPERIENCE: A minimum of 5 years OEM enterprise software sales experience and a strong technical understanding of software solutions in similar industries, with a proven track record of success.
EDUCATION: A BA/BS degree is required. Technical disciplines and advanced degrees are preferred.
REQUIREMENTS:
- A highly successful track record of calling on and closing at the senior business and technical executive level - especially CTO, VP Product Management, VP Sales/Marketing, VP Product Development/Engineering.
- Consistent and verifiable earnings history of quota overachievement, with demonstrated success of multi-year quota achievement
- Demonstrated experience selling in one of the following software industries: search, business intelligence, Records/ Content/Document Management, eCommerce, CRM, ERP, accounting, email and/or content archiving, or corporate data security.
- Strong presentation, public speaking, demonstrating, written and verbal communication skills are required.
- The ability to work well in an entrepreneurial environment. The ability to innovate and create opportunities out of uncertainty
- Highly motivated self starter with a passion for selling and winning.
- Strong people skills and an ability to listen to partners and customers and translate their needs into actionable pre-sales tasks and new business proposals.
- Ability to overcome objections and challenges.
- Experience using a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system (e.g. Dynamics CRM).
- Working knowledge of Windows-based environments and Microsoft Office applications.
- Must possess managerial aspirations.
- Willing to travel; travel could be more than 50%.
COMPENSATION & BENEFITS: M-Files offers excellent compensation including a base salary plus commission on sales. There is no cap on commission. Benefits include a choice of plans providing comprehensive coverage for medical, dental, vision care for employee & dependents, as well as employee life, long term disability, 2 weeks vacation and 10 paid holidays.

Digital Marketing/Web Graphics Specialist (USA: Dallas, TX)
M-Files in Dallas, TX is looking for a talented and motivated individual to help execute marketing programs to fuel our rapid growth. This is primarily a hands-on graphics and email marketing position that requires a high degree of creativity and some ability to code, as well as ability to work in a highly collaborative "start-up atmosphere". You will also assist with a company-wide rebranding effort currently underway. Candidate must be local to the Dallas-Fort Worth area or willing to relocate without sponsorship.
The Digital Marketing Specialist is responsible for the development, implementation, production, and continuous improvement of a wide range of online marketing campaigns, including but not limited to email marketing, creating image/banner ads, website content updates and social media management.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Design and code email marketing messages and landing pages for conversion points
- Create banner ads and graphics using Adobe CS programs
- Update website content as needed using CMS
- Management of SEO/SEM agency
- Social media updates, including Facebook, Twitter and LinkedIn accounts
REQUIRED SKILLS:
- Bachelors or equivalent in Graphic Design, Web Design, Marketing, Business, or Communications
- Minimum of 2 years experience using Adobe CS (Photoshop, Illustrator, Dreamweaver)
- Photoshop, HTML, and CSS for both web and email marketing required; familiar with design limitations for email design
- Understanding of search engines, SEO/SEM, and Google Analytics
- Business-level writing skills
- Familiarity with social media marketing (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n) for B2B highly desirable
- Experience using a marketing automation tool, CMS, WordPress, ASP, Flash and SVN all highly desirable
COMPENSATION & BENEFITS: M-Files offers excellent compensation including a competitive salary based experience, and benefits. Benefits include a choice of plans providing comprehensive coverage for medical, dental, vision care for employee & dependents, as well as employee life, long term disability, 2 weeks vacation and 10 paid holidays.

Technical Consultant (USA)
JOB DESCRIPTION A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
As a M-Files IT Systems Consultant, you are a key part of the Motive sales and support team and will play a critical role in driving our success. You will need to become an expert in the M-Files document management software, and have an outgoing personality that will enable you to relate to customers and help discern their needs and determine how M-Files can benefit their business.
Your day-to-day tasks will consist of performing M-Files system implementations that include defining customer needs, integrating M-Files with customers' existing systems such as accounting or CRM software, and conducting customer training. In addition you will be providing first-line customer support and second-line support to resellers. Travel could be as high as 50% or more.
MINIMUM EXPERIENCE: 1 to 3 years in a technology-centric environment with some amount of customer-facing experience. A background in technical sales, technical sales support or application engineering would be very helpful.
EDUCATION: BS or equivalent
REQUIREMENTS:
- Highly motivated self starter, willing to travel
- Ability to drive projects to completion and manage obstacles
- Proven ability to communicate ideas with exc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Excellent organizational skills
- Strong knowledge of Windows-based environments
- Working knowledge of Microsoft Office applications including Word, Excel, and Powerpoint
- Working knowledge of networks and the Internet
- Strong people skills and an ability to listen to the customer and translate their needs into specific actions and solutions
- Aptitude and enthusiasm for learning new methods and techniques
- Experience and working knowledge of databases a plus
- Experience with document/content management systems a plus
COMPENSATION & BENEFITS: The Technical Consultant position offers a competitive salary with the potential for a bonus. Benefits include a choice of plans providing comprehensive coverage for medical, dental, vision care for employee & dependents, as well as employee life, long term disability, paid vacation and holidays.
